Politics Step aside: Ukraine plans to impose economic sanctions against Iran Думитру Удря April 27, 2023April 27, 2023 The Cabinet of Ministers of Ukraine has developed a special package of sanctions against the Islamic Republic of Iran (IRI). It is assumed that official...